CNN has finally caught up to what I’ve been saying for awhile now: McCain will win Virginia, but it won’t be pretty. It’s basically a two-man race, and McCain is still polling under 50%, thanks to votes for Ron Paul and some of the candidates who have already dropped out but still have their names on the ballot.
I’ve said to look at the suburbs. McCain is taking Fairfax with 63% of the vote. But he only took 52% of the vote in Prince William County. He’s winning Spotsylvania by 48-43. And he’s not up by much in the first precincts to report from Loudoun County.
Closer to home for us, Huckabee is thumping McCain in Roanoke County.
